Thinking of time as the dimension orthogonal to depth, it seems logical that the rate at which a body moves through time could vary. Do units exist for rate of movement through time? The numerator seems clear (e.g. seconds), but what could the denominator be?

Finally one can indeed have multiple times (eg in special relativity) where there is a proper time (of an object) and the time as dimension in space-time. This is a 3rd answer – Nikos M. Jun 03 '14 at 07:36

There is no universal rate. We each 'time' at different rates, but we can compare 'your second' per 'my second', or 'per second on earth at sea level' – zane scheepers Apr 03 '19 at 14:11
